AST SpaceMobile is building the first and only global cellular broadband network in space to operate directly with standard, unmodified mobile devices based on our extensive IP and patent portfolio and designed for both commercial and government applications. Our engineers and space scientists are on a mission to eliminate the connectivity gaps faced by today's five billion mobile subscribers and finally bring broadband to the billions who remain unconnected.
Position Overview
The Associate Manufacturing Engineer will support the development, evaluation, and continuous improvement of manufacturing methods and processes to sustain current production and support the introduction of new products. This role contributes to manufacturing readiness, process optimization, and the successful transition of products from design to production.
Key Responsibilities
- Assess new product concepts and designs for manufacturability, providing recommendations to R&D/Product Engineering.
- Develop methods and processes for manufacturing new products in the safest, most cost-effective manner while meeting quality standards and production demand.
- Conduct proof-of-principle or proof-of-concept studies to validate manufacturing approaches.
- Design detailed manufacturing processes, including layouts, tooling, fixtures, programming, testing, and documentation.
- Continuously improve existing production methods using Six Sigma methodologies and knowledge of product design, materials, fabrication processes, tooling, equipment capabilities, assembly techniques, and quality standards.
- Troubleshoot technical issues in current production and provide engineering support to operations.
- Participate in or lead Safety, Kaizen, and other continuous improvement initiatives.
- Support the qualification of new or modified products through manufacturing processes to final completion.
